Mars Foodservice launches student catering challenge
Mars Foodservice, the manufacturers of Uncle Ben's and Dolmio, are encouraging young chefs to showcase their talent through the launch of the brand's Foodservice Student Catering Challenge.
To enter, students must design two dishes suitable for a casual-dining menu using Dolmio and Uncle Ben's products. Students can choose to make either a vegetarian starter and a gluten-free main course, or a gluten-free main course and a dessert.
A panel of judges will choose eight entrants to go through to a final cook-off on 23 January 2017 at the Great Hospitality Show.
There, the students will be asked to create a three-course menu in the hope of being named ‘best starter', ‘best main course', ‘best dessert' or ‘best overall menu'.
The winner of each category will receive £200 of Nisbets vouchers to spend on professional catering equipment. The winner of ‘best overall menu' will receive £400 of Nisbets vouchers.
All the finalists will receive a Dolmio & Uncle Ben's Foodservice Student Catering Challenge chef's jacket embroidered with their name.
Willem Fijten, culinary product design scientist in the Mars Global Product Development team, said: "Mars Foodservice is extremely dedicated to all aspects of the future within foodservice and engaging with the next generation of chefs is the next step in supporting this global initiative.
"I'm hugely excited by the challenge and am looking forward to seeing what our future young chefs have in store for us!"
